Definitions For Loosening

noun

  • The act of making something less tight
  • An occurrence of control or strength weakening

verb

  • To make (something) less tight or firm : to make (something) loose or looser
  • To become less tight or firm : to become loose or looser
  • To become or to cause (something) to become less strict
